Frequently Asked Questions
What is the average MOT pass rate for a Iveco Daily 35s15?
The Iveco Daily 35s15 has an average 57.1% MOT pass rate across model years 2012 to 2013, based on DVSA test data.
What are the most common MOT failures on a Iveco Daily 35s15?
The most common MOT failure reasons for the Iveco Daily 35s15 across all years are: a suspension pin, bush or joint excessively worn, the aim of a headlamp is not within limits laid down in the requirements, a lamp missing, inoperative or in the case of a multiple light source more than 1/2 not functioning. These are typical wear items that can often be checked and addressed before your test.
